Why is the GRNN much slower than a GRU

Open jambo6 opened this issue 3 years ago • 1 comments

from torch import nn
from rnn import FastGRNNCUDA

x = torch.randn((8192, 4, 512)).cuda()
h0 = torch.zeros((4, 512)).cuda()
    
gru = nn.GRU(512, 512, batch_first=False).cuda()
grnn = FastGRNNCUDA(512, 512, batch_first=False).cuda()

Timing (with proper cuda synchronisation) gives a loop time of 0.1s for the GRU and 0.35s for the GRNN. Am I doing something wrong, surely the GRNN should be at least on par with the GRU since it is less operations.

Hi,

Thanks for the timing numbers. IIRC, I don't think we optimized GRNN to the level of inbuilt GRU and that shows evidently here. The speedups are obvious when you use GRU and GRNN from our own naive implementations.
